Understanding Event Contracts and Market Dynamics
At the heart of Kalshi’s functionality lie event contracts. These contracts represent a financial stake in the occurrence or non-occurrence of a specific future event. For example, a contract might exist for “Will the U.S. GDP growth exceed 2.5% in Q3 2024?”. Traders can buy contracts, effectively betting that the event will happen, or they can sell contracts, betting that it will not. The price of a contract fluctuates between $0 and $100, reflecting the market’s collective belief in the probability of the event. A price of $60 indicates a 60% probability, while $30 suggests a 30% probability. The key to success lies in accurately predicting the market’s evolution and capitalizing on discrepancies between your own assessment and the prevailing price. Unlike traditional betting, Kalshi allows you to close your position at any time, locking in a profit or limiting a loss.
The Role of Liquidity and Market Makers
A crucial component of a well-functioning market is liquidity – the ease with which contracts can be bought and sold without significantly impacting the price. Kalshi employs various mechanisms to encourage liquidity, including incentivizing market makers. Market makers are participants who provide both buy and sell orders, narrowing the spread between the best bid and ask prices. They play a vital role in ensuring that traders can execute their strategies efficiently. Furthermore, the platform’s design encourages active participation from a diverse range of traders, contributing to greater market depth and stability. The more diverse the opinions and analyses represented in the market, the more accurate the collective prediction is likely to be. This makes price discovery on Kalshi potentially more reliable than in traditional markets where information asymmetry can be a significant issue.

Kalshi's Competitive Advantages and Distinctions
Kalshi differentiates itself from traditional prediction markets and sports betting platforms through its regulatory framework and its focus on a broad range of events. Being designated as a Designated Contract Market (DCM) by the Commodity Futures Trading Commission (CFTC) provides Kalshi with a unique legal standing. This allows it to offer event contracts on a wider variety of topics than traditional betting exchanges, including political outcomes, which are often subject to stricter regulations elsewhere. This regulatory clarity fosters trust and encourages institutional participation. Furthermore, Kalshi’s platform is designed with sophisticated trading tools and data analytics, providing traders with a more professional trading experience. The emphasis on transparency and real-time data empowers users to make informed decisions.

Risk Management and Trading Strategies on Kalshi
Trading on Kalshi, like any financial market, involves risk. However, the platform's structure allows for sophisticated risk management techniques. One key strategy is diversification – spreading investments across multiple contracts to reduce exposure to any single event. Position sizing is also crucial; traders should carefully determine the appropriate amount of capital to allocate to each contract based on their risk tolerance and conviction level. Furthermore, understanding the correlations between different events can help refine trading strategies. For example, economic indicators might be correlated with political outcomes, providing opportunities for arbitrage. The continuous trading nature of Kalshi also allows for employing stop-loss orders to limit potential losses and take-profit orders to lock in gains.

Expanding Applications: Beyond Prediction
While often viewed as a tool for forecasting, the underlying mechanisms of platforms like Kalshi can be harnessed for applications extending far beyond simply predicting the future. Consider the potential for using event contracts as a mechanism for corporate insurance. A company facing the risk of a specific event, such as a product recall or a natural disaster, could create a contract that pays out if the event occurs. This effectively transfers the risk to the market, allowing the company to hedge against potential losses. Another interesting application lies in the realm of decentralized governance. Event contracts could be used to create mechanisms for collective decision-making, where the outcome of a vote is determined by the price of a contract representing the chosen option.
